Pricing:

  • ​Camp holds two groups at a time. Each group will get a new cabin and a old cabin for overflow (if required).

  • Our rates are $135 a person per night. Minimums are 6 ppl 3 nights.

  • If one group wants to book both cabins there is a discount which drops the minimums from 6 to 5 people per cabin. Booking both cabins would give you the entire camp.​

  • Each cabin comes with two 14' boats.

About Us

Pearson Lake Lodge is one of Alberta's best kept secrets in the Fort McMurray region of Northern Alberta. Pearson Lake is unique to the area and caters to those looking to shut off from the outside world and create their own adventure. Traveler's who book the lodge have full access to the boats, generator, both cabins, a sauna, hot water shower, and of course, a lake filled with fish.

Forget the Bass, Pearson is all about that Walleye

 

The fishing at Pearson gets better each year due to the health of the lake, and of the responsibility of those fishing. Please respect the fish so future generations can have the full Pearson Lake experience.

​

Pearson Lake boasts 3 km x 1.5 km of clean, blue water surrounded by sandy beaches perfect for an afternoon fish fry. However, it's what lies beneath the water that keeps people coming back year after year. Walleye and pike are abundant and offer anglers of all levels a fun challenge. Some of the big pikes can keep you busy for 15 minutes or more, so make sure you have a strong line. While the walleye may not put up as much of a fight, you will never get bored reeling in fish after fish. 

​

Guests can troll, bob, or fly fish and will find fish in all areas of the lake. The calm water between the island, sandy shoals near shore, and 30 foot drops in the open water are all home to the fish of Pearson Lake.

The Camp

Camp holds two groups at a time.

 

Each group will get:

​

  • ​Two 14" boats

  • A new cabin (Eagle or Bear)

  • If your group size is over six one of the older cabins will be included in your stay.

​

The cabins have all the amenities of home.

  • Wood stove

  • Fridge and propane stove. 

  • All cookware

  • TV and stereo

  • Toilets and shower with hot water on demand. 

  • Starlink WiFi
